Abstract
The present invention concerns a stabilized ferromagnetic chromium dioxide and a process for obtaining the same. More particularly, the present invention relates to ferromagnetic chromium dioxide stabilized by means of the coating of its particles with a stabilizing substance, characterized in that the stabilizing substance is selected from the group consisting of a zinc, aluminum or chromium (III) polyphosphates having a high molar ratio phosphorus/metal and having, depending on the metal, the following formula: P.sub.2 O.sub.5.nZnO.mH.sub.2 O wherein 'n' in general is comprised between 0.286 and 0.667 while 'm' is generally comprised between 0 and 2.570; P.sub.2 o.sub.5.nAl.sub.2 O.sub.3.mH.sub.2 O wherein 'n' is in general comprised between 0.225 and 0.500, while 'm' is generally comprised between 0 and 2.68; P.sub.2 o.sub.5.nCr.sub.2 O.sub.3.mH.sub.2 O wherein 'n' is in general comprised between 0.143 and 0.333, while 'm' is generally comprised between 0.002 and 2.46.
